The 9th Annual Blairsville Extreme Adventure Race (BEAR) will take place on Saturday, September 23, 2023. The race will start at Meeks Park in Blairsville, GA on Saturday. Teams will be exploring the mountains, rivers, lakes, trails, and beautiful woods surrounding Blairsville, Georgia, home of the highest mountain in Georgia. Divisions include solo, 2-, 3-, or 4-person teams, coed or open (same-sex).

Details
This 10-hour adventure race is perfect for sport or family teams looking to have some fun discovering the outdoors with adventure racing. Easy to read and simple navigation will take you to some hidden spots around Blairsville.
Distances are always based on your team's abilities and speed in adventure racing; however, you can expect between 25-35 miles of mountain biking, 8-9 miles of trekking with 6-10 miles of canoeing.
Check-in starts at 6:00am to 7:30am with instructions and (pre-plotted) map followed by a pre-race meeting at 7:30am.
All teammates must be present to check-in and receive instructions. The later you are, the shorter the time to prepare. Your first discipline to start the race will be revealed during check-in.
We supply all canoes, paddles, and PFDs; however, teams may bring their own paddle gear if placed in paddle bags. Water and snacks will be provided at most transition areas; however, not guaranteed so bring water purification tablets.
Race Includes: t-shirt, food and drink during the race, awards for each division, and dinner at the end of the race.
